Ever see the birthday card:  "for the man who has everything.....a bag to put it in!"   Cute.  I found that my bench works the same:  need bag.  So I had a scrap piece of 1x6 maple, ran some grooves down it. [Next time I'll use a dado blade]  The grooves keep things from rolling around.  [the stuff above the block:  all the stuff that was on the block before the pic]   The red color helps it stand out.  Whenever I can't remember what some tool is doing there, I finally put it away.  [It's all about discipline:  ah hain't got none]  I found that the block needs some wider (3/8") grooves for the larger handles, such as the chisel, or they'll roll.  It really helps prevent "bit, bit, where'd I put the bit?" time wasting.
